OK, I'll jump in this evening. My Wife paid for this and I ordered early as they seem to be produced on demand and you have to wait. And I did for three weeks or so but it's here! Perhaps too early but you never know with Corvette suppliers??

So what is it? That's a cabin, sturdy vinyl, weather-proof cover for a C3 convertible. Put your top down in the spring and never put it up until autumn thus avoiding movement damage. Have a show in the summer and rain threatens? Then just pop this on. Attaches at the windshield wipers, bottom of the doors, and normal soft-top latches on the rear deck. Very nice unit.
